TVP welcomes new DCC as part of changes to senior management

Former Hampshire DCC Ben Snuggs has taken up his new role with Thames Valley Police following Jason Hogg?s promotion to Chief Constable.
Published - 13/04/2023 By - Cash Boyle

Thames Valley Police (TVP) has made a number of changes to senior management, including the appointment of a new Deputy Chief Constable who already has strong ties to the force.

DCC Ben Snuggs, who held the same role at Hampshire and Isle of Wight Constabulary, has started work after being formally appointed in January.

The new DCC was Hampshire's temporary Chief Constable when the outgoing Olivia Pinkney took over the Strategic Command Course.

He said: “As Deputy Chief Constable, my focus is clear; supporting our new Chief Constable and his vision for Thames Valley Police, and delivering excellent performance that will make our communities proud of us through a bedrock of neighbourhood policing, quality investigations and excellent response,” he said.

DCC Snuggs is already well known to the force, having previously acted as Assistant Chief Constable for Joint Operations for TVP and Hampshire.

TVP has made other changes to its senior management.

ACC Rob France, who was previously ACC for Crime, Criminal Justice, Intelligence and Tasking and Development at Hampshire, will now oversee Joint Operations.

ACC Dennis Murray will be taking on a new role within the force focusing on legitimacy and value to the communities served by TVP.

His previous role will be filled by Katy Barrow-Grint who is now T/ACC for Crime and Criminal Justice.
